What companies run services between Home Latin, Paris, France and Gare Montparnasse, Île-de-France, France?

RATP Metro operates a subway from Maubert - Mutualité to Duroc every 10 minutes.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 7 min. Alternatively, Régie Autonome des Transports Parisiens (RATP) operates a bus from Saint-Michel to Gare Montparnasse every 15 minutes.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 19 min.
